有没有办法使用 API v3 关闭 google 地图中的所有标签(街道名称、州名称、国家/地区名称等)?或者这些直接内置到地图图像中?
是的,您可以使用 Google Maps API v3 的Styled Maps 功能来完成此操作。
具体来说,此样式将禁用所有标签:
[
{
featureType: "all",
elementType: "labels",
stylers: [
{ visibility: "off" }
]
}
]
您可以使用以下方法将其应用到当前地图:
var customStyled = [];//(array shown above)
map.set('styles',customStyled);
是的, 您可以使用样式地图功能直接在 CSS 代码中更改标签可见性属性
或直接使用样式地图向导网站